提升MyEclipse启动速度:优化设置与指数更新

需积分: 8 0 下载量 117 浏览量 更新于2024-09-13 收藏 2KB TXT 举报
"本文主要介绍了如何优化MyEclipse的启动速度,包括禁用索引更新、调整内存分配、禁用不必要的插件和服务、优化验证设置等方法,旨在提高开发环境的运行效率。" 在开发过程中,MyEclipse作为一款强大的Java集成开发环境,其启动速度对开发效率有着直接影响。以下是一些针对MyEclipse启动速度优化的策略: 1. 禁用索引更新:MyEclipse在启动时会自动更新Maven仓库的索引,这会消耗大量时间和系统资源。可以通过以下步骤禁用此功能:进入`Window > Preferences > Myeclipse Enterprise Workbench > Maven4Myeclipse > Maven > Repositories`,取消勾选`Download repository index updates on startup`。同时,也可以在`Window > Preferences > General > Startup and Shutdown > Automatic Updates Scheduler`中取消更新调度,以减少启动时的后台活动。 2. 调整内存分配:默认情况下,MyEclipse可能会占用过多的系统资源,特别是内存。为了优化启动速度,可以适当降低其占用的系统资源。在MyEclipse安装目录下的`myeclipse.ini`文件中,调整`-Xms`和`-Xmx`参数,例如将`-Xms`设置为总内存的20%,`-Xmx`设置为总内存的80%,确保MyEclipse启动时只使用20%的系统内存,运行时最多使用80%。 3. 禁用不必要的插件和服务:一些不常用的插件和服务会拖慢启动速度。可以在`Window > Preferences > General > Startup and Shutdown`中查看并禁用不需要的启动项。此外,对于MyEclipse Dashboard,如果不需要在启动时显示,也可在此处进行关闭。 4. 减少WTP(Web Tools Platform)的影响:如果项目中不涉及WTP支持的功能,可以选择禁用或移除相关的WTP插件,以减少启动时的加载负担。 5. 禁用Mylyn:如果未使用Mylyn任务管理功能,可以将其禁用,以节省资源。同样,在`Window > Preferences`中找到并禁用Mylyn。 6. 移除Derby数据库:如果项目中不使用Derby数据库,可将Derby相关的jar文件从类路径中移除,避免无谓的加载。 7. 优化EASIE配置:对于EASIE(Enterprise Application Software Integration Environment),可以根据实际需求选择加载服务器。在`Preferences`中选择`MyEclipse - Validation`,将不需要的Validator设为手动触发,减少启动时的验证过程。 8. 禁用拼写检查:对于文本编辑器的拼写检查,可以在`Window > Preferences > General > Validation > Editors > Text Editors > Spelling`中关闭,以减少启动时的处理。 通过以上步骤,可以显著提升MyEclipse的启动速度,提高开发效率。记得在调整设置后重启MyEclipse以应用更改。在优化过程中,根据个人工作环境和项目的具体需求进行选择,以达到最佳的性能效果。